' :SUBJECTi ' CORE INTERNALS UPPER GUIDE STRUCTURE LIFTING RIG FAILURE 10n 1the morning; of1 ovember 6 while. removing the St. Lucie Unit 1~ co.re internals upper N
- guide structure in preparation for fuel movement, one of three lifting rig attachments.gave way. ; This 'placed the upper guide structure in a tilted position.with its full ; weight '
supported by.the. remaining two attachment points.
Refueling operations were immediately
- st:pped withlthe Lstructure suspended in an apparently stable position with its bottom at a Llevel?approximately even with the reactor. vessel-flange.
No fuel damage has occurred and ino abnormal' radiation levels have ~ resulted.- The licensee is contacting the Nuclear Steam LSupply System' Vendor (Combustion Engineering)-to evaluate the situation.
Florida Power and' Light (FPL) ' declared an unusual event at 10:45 a.m...(EST) in accordance 4
,with the plant emergency plan.-
- Th2 State of Florida >has been; informed.
